Full job description

Location: Hybrid – East Kilbride / Home Working
Salary: £25,000–£30,000, depending on experience

Join one of the leading professional hair, barbering and beauty media groups

EVO Media Group is the publisher of BarberEVO and SalonEVO - internationally recognised media brands serving the professional barbering, hair and beauty industries across North America, the UK and beyond.

Through premium print magazines, websites, social media, video content and live events, we connect professionals with the people, brands, trends and ideas shaping the future of the industry.

We are looking for an ambitious Editorial, Features & Digital Content Writer who can tell great stories, build strong industry relationships and produce high-quality editorial content across print, digital and social platforms.

This is a fast-paced, high-output editorial role. It is not suited to someone who wants to spend days perfecting one article or waiting for work to be handed to them.

You will be expected to write quickly and accurately, chase leads, secure interviews, pick up the phone, manage multiple deadlines and turn content around across print, digital, social and commercial platforms.

The right person will be comfortable producing a steady volume of content without letting quality, accuracy or tone slip.

You will interview artists, educators, brand leaders, business owners and industry voices across the UK, North America and international markets, while helping produce content for magazines, websites, newsletters, social channels, live events and commercial partners.

If you are naturally curious, confident speaking to people, full of ideas and comfortable working at pace, this could be a brilliant opportunity.

The Role

You will create engaging editorial content across our print magazines, websites, newsletters, social platforms and wider media channels.

From interviewing award-winning artists and global educators to covering trade shows, launches, brand stories and industry news, no two days are the same.

This role requires pace, organisation and initiative. You may be working on print features, website stories, interview transcripts, advertorial copy, social captions and event coverage within the same week, so the ability to prioritise and keep moving is essential.

Working alongside our Director of Content Strategy and wider editorial team, you will produce high-quality written content at pace while maintaining the editorial standards our brands are known for.

As our North American audience continues to grow, flexibility around working hours will be required to support interviews, events and editorial deadlines across different time zones. This is not suited to someone looking for a rigid 9–5 role.

Key Responsibilities

  • Research, pitch and write original feature articles, interviews and editorial content for print and digital platforms.
  • Produce engaging editorial for magazines, websites, newsletters and social media.
  • Generate original story ideas, interview opportunities and fresh editorial angles.
  • Proactively chase leads, contacts, interviews and story opportunities rather than waiting for assignments to be handed over.
  • Build relationships with artists, educators, brands, salon owners, barbers and industry leaders across the UK, North America and international markets.
  • Arrange, conduct and transcribe interviews via phone, video call and in person.
  • Confidently communicate with contributors, PR agencies, clients and commercial partners.
  • Adapt long-form editorial into digital stories, newsletters, captions, pull quotes and social-first content.
  • Write advertorial and partner-led content while maintaining editorial standards and tone of voice.
  • Fact-check names, titles, quotes, brand details and technical claims before publication.
  • Monitor industry trends, emerging news, audience interests and competitor activity.
  • Support editorial coverage around product launches, business developments and major industry events.
  • Represent EVO Media Group at trade shows, exhibitions and industry events, conducting interviews and producing live editorial content where required.
  • Collaborate with designers, photographers, videographers and the commercial team to deliver engaging multi-platform content.
